AB  - This study presents trend analyses in several catchments across Serbia. The trend analyses are preformed over series of precipitation, temperature and streamflows. These variables are represented by different indicators, such as the total annual precipitation, or maximum daily precipitation depth, temperature, and streamflow rate. The indicators are selected to represent different features of the catchment hydroclimatical regimes, such as mean or extreme conditions, or seasonality, and are all computed at the annual level. The
Mann-Kendall test for trend is applied over these annual series of indicators, and the series that result in the test null hypothesis rejection at 5% are considered to exhibit a statistically significant trend. The results of the Mann-Kendall test are complemented by the Sens’ slope estimator values, which indicate a sign of a trend. The trend analyses are further extended to joint considerations of concurrent occurrence of trends in climatical and hydrological indicators in the same catchment by conducting a correlation analysis. The objective of these analyses is to examine if the trends in climatical variables inevitably translate to trends in streamflow-related indicators, i.e., hydrological signatures, which is important in context of climate change and effective water resources management.
